Material & Composition

ITEM SPECIFICATION
Material Aluminum Laminated Film
Polyamide (JIS Z1714) 0.025 mm (+/-0.0025 mm)
Adhesive (Polyester-polyurethane) 4-5 g/m2
Aluminum foil (JIS A8079,A8021) 0.040 mm (+/-0.004 mm)
Adhesive (Urethane-free Adhesive) 2-3 g/m2
Polypropylene 0.040 mm (+/-0.004 mm)

Quality Inspection

ITEM SPECIFICATION
Surface quality Mat finish
Pinholes Subject to applicable aluminum foil standard
Impurity 1 mm or less in diameter
Fish eye 2 mm or less in diameter (clear), 1 mm or less in diameter (coloured)
Molding Depth >= 5.0 mm
Electrical Insulating Good
Hot Sealing Condition 180-190 C
Moisture Vapor / O2 Transmission Rate 200 ppm / 5 years
Laminate Strength Nylon/Al more than 2 N/15 mm; Al/CPP more than 5 N/15 mm
Heat seal strength More than 29.4 N/15 mm wide at 200 C x 0.2 MPa x 2 sec on heatsealing equipment
Solvent Retention Less than 5 mg/m2
Appearance Within the sample of the limit
Slip Factor CPP/CPP less than 1.0

This aluminum-plastic film requires hot sealing at 180-190°C to achieve proper adhesion. The heat seal strength must exceed 29.4 N/15 mm width when sealed at 200°C with 0.2 MPa pressure for 2 seconds.

  • Hot Sealing Temperature: The hot sealing condition is specified at 180-190°C.
  • Heat Seal Strength Requirement: Heat seal strength must be greater than 29.4 N/15 mm width at 200°C, 0.2 MPa, and 2 seconds dwell time.
  • Laminate Strength: Nylon/Al laminate strength must exceed 2 N/15 mm and Al/CPP laminate strength must exceed 5 N/15 mm.
  • Solvent Retention Limit: Solvent retention must be less than 5 mg/m².
  • Moisture Vapor Transmission Rate: Moisture vapor transmission rate is specified as 200 ppm over 5 years.

Inspect the film for surface defects before use. Heat seal the pouch at 180-190°C with controlled pressure and dwell time to achieve the required seal strength.

Required Equipment: Heatsealing equipment, Pouch forming die

  1. Inspect Film
    Inspect the punched film for surface defects, pinholes, and impurities before processing.
  2. Form Pouch
    Position the film in the pouch forming die and apply heat to achieve a molding depth of at least 5.0 mm.
  3. Heat Seal
    Heat seal the pouch at 180-190°C using appropriate pressure and dwell time.
  4. Verify Seal Strength
    Verify that the heat seal strength exceeds 29.4 N/15 mm width when tested at 200°C with 0.2 MPa pressure for 2 seconds.
